Do I have to be a member to travel with Ambassadair?

0

Most of the Clubs trips are available to members only. (Click here for information on joining the Club.) Nonmembers may travel with the Club on select Trip Specials. All Ambassadors for Children volunteer trips are open to the public. Occasionally, special-event trips, such as trips to watch sport teams in the post-season, are often open to the public. Members may take guests on Ambassadair trips. Each guest pays a $75 Limited Member Fee per trip.
